Gackt's Best Album!
| If by now you have decided to set foot into the fandom of Gackt, this is the CD to get. Gackt is at his best with all the rock ballads. My favorite Tracks are 3, 4, 6, Mind Forest, The Last Song and Birdcage. I've rated this CD with all 5 stars with the exception of Dybbuk, Solitary and White Eyes which are 4 stars tracks. Gackt shows a lot of emotions and feelings in The Last Song, the moon & star tracks (Tracks 3 & 4). I like him best when he is not straining his vocals. Gackt is an amazing composer and singer. You have to listen to Lust For Blood, a track which is mysterious, atmospheric, sad and powerful. Gackt, the 'Vampire' shows all his attractiveness and mysticism. Beauty is in the eyes of the beholder. I'm sure you will find other favorites from him. |

Perfect
| Every song on this CD has a great melody, singing and music. There is not one song that I don't like, though I can understand why fans don't like "Dybbuk", I think the song is cool. My favorite songs on the album are "White Eyes", "mind forest", "Lust for Blood", "Birdcage", "Last song" and "Hoshi no suna". The album exclusive tracks are better than the single ones, I owned the singles before this and listened to them so many times that the album exclusive tracks made the album totally worth it. |

AMAZING
| This album is simply amazing! Tracks like Mind Forest and Kimi ga Matteiru Kara simply take yu away to a new world with their beautiful instrumentation. Gackt is at his best here. Lust for Blood has the power to make your blood run cold just by listening to the opening with its chilling instrumentations.It reminds me so much of his Malice Mizer days. Another great track is Kimi ga Matteiru Kara. It is very emotional but strong at the same time. I'll leave the rest for yu to critique. Buy this album. You WILL NOT be disappointed. |
